Edit. From TSB,
P0171 - System Too Lean (Bank 1) The Adaptive Fuel Strategy continuously monitors fuel delivery hardware. The code is set when the adaptive fuel tables reach a rich calibrated limit.

Fuel System:
�· Contaminated fuel injectors
�· Low fuel pressure or running out of fuel (fuel pump, filter, fuel supply line restrictions)
�· Vapor recovery system (VMV)

Induction System:
�· MAF contamination
�· Air leaks between the MAF and throttle body
�· Vacuum leaks
�· PCV system concern
�· Improperly seated engine oil dipstick

EGR System:
�· Leaking gasket
�· Stuck EGR valve
�· Leaking diaphragm or EVR

Base Engine:
�· Exhaust leaks before or near the HO2S
�· Secondary air concern

Powertrain Control System:
�· PCM concern
